Remove unneeded macros. Remove empty header.
[bertos.git] / bertos / cpu / types.h
index 08772a97daaa5b9f72799fa78122284d4f18f1eb..cbef8c4126f38916d0d8e158ff36b2d9b34fced2 100644 (file)
@@ -241,16 +241,6 @@ STATIC_ASSERT(sizeof(size_t) == SIZEOF_SIZE_T);
 #define HWREG(x)   (*((reg32_t *)(x)))
 #define HWREGH(x)  (*((reg16_t *)(x)))
 #define HWREGB(x)  (*((reg8_t *)(x)))
-
-#define HWREGBITW(x, b) \
-        HWREG(((reg32_t)(x) & 0xF0000000) | 0x02000000 |               \
-              (((reg32_t)(x) & 0x000FFFFF) << 5) | ((b) << 2))
-#define HWREGBITH(x, b) \
-        HWREGH(((reg32_t)(x) & 0xF0000000) | 0x02000000 |              \
-               (((reg32_t)(x) & 0x000FFFFF) << 5) | ((b) << 2))
-#define HWREGBITB(x, b) \
-        HWREGB(((reg32_t)(x) & 0xF0000000) | 0x02000000 |              \
-               (((reg32_t)(x) & 0x000FFFFF) << 5) | ((b) << 2))
 /*\}*/
 
 #endif /* CPU_TYPES_H */